//! Heap usage report for [`PhyloTree`].
//!
//! This is a reporting tool rather than a pass/fail test, so it is `#[ignore]`d
//! and does not run in CI. Run it explicitly:
//!
//! ```text
//! cargo test --release --test memory-report -- --ignored --nocapture
//! ```
//!
//! It exists to make the effect of a layout change legible: run it before and
//! after, and diff. `divan` measures time, so it is the wrong tool for bytes.
